A colony of Bacillus subtilis survived on the outside of a NASA satellite for six years. The colony morphology of B. subtilis refers to how it appears in large quantities. As a group, this bacteria is observed as jagged branches of opaque white or pale yellow fuzz. The Bacillus subtilis is a Gram-positive bacterium isolated from the soil originally. Sporulating cultures of Bacillus subtilis form sub-populations which include vegetative cells, spore forming cells and spores. Bacillus subtilis and B. velezensis are frequently isolated from various niches, including fermented foods, water, and soil.
